Leader: Siblings in Christ, we come to worship today with expectations: how we expect
to feel, what we expect to experience, songs we expect to sing, or prayers we expect
to pray. We find comfort in our traditions.
People: We come to worship, confident that God will
meet us here.
Leader: But sometimes our prayers, scriptures, hymns, and liturgies become rote.
Remember
your wonder at our awesome God.
People: We come to worship, remembering the God
of wonders.
Leader: We may meet God in a familiar voice speaking a challenging word, in a song we
love that touches our hearts, in a prayer that we receive in a new way. Because God
is here, moving and working among
us.
People: We come to worship, expecting God to be
faithful as God always is.
Leader: Children of God, come! Let us worship, ready to embrace God’s Word already at
work among us, even when we are challenged to recognize God in the familiar and
unfamiliar alike.
All: We
come to worship, expecting God to meet us here. Thank be to God! AMEN.

Holy Communion will be served at the chancel rail this morning. At the direction of the ushers,
you will be invited forward. You may kneel or stand at the kneelers. You will then receive a piece
of bread from a communion server. After receiving the bread, you will receive a cup of grape
juice and after consuming the elements, you will be dismissed by the pastor to return to your seat.
If you are unable to come forward for Holy Communion servers will serve you in your seat.
